近20年,增益现实技术随着相关技术的快速发展,已越来越多的被用于多个学科。医学工作者和工程人员合作在该技术的应用上作出了一些突破,例如微创外科利用增益现实技术,为外科医生从人体体表、器官表面提供内部解剖等信息,以期达到易化学习和手术导航的目的。医学增益现实技术目前已被用于手术计划制定、手术演练、手术教学、手术技能训练和术中引导等医学治疗过程。本文回顾了医学增益现实技术得以实现的关键技术,在各微创外科亚专业的应用、面临的问题以及未来的发展趋势。
